Tesco Stores Ltd v Khattawi & Anor [2024] EW Misc 9 (CC) (09 February 2024)

Tesco Stores Ltd v Khattawi & Anor [2024] EW Misc 9 (CC) (09 February 2024)

The court found the accident was staged as part of a large-scale conspiracy to defraud Tesco, with Khattawi and Taylor both active participants. Tesco was entitled to recover the interim payment, repair costs, and investigation costs. Given the scale and egregiousness of the fraud, exemplary damages of £20,000 were awarded against Khattawi and £18,000 against Taylor.

  1. 1 Whether the accident was staged as part of a conspiracy to defraud Tesco
  2. 2 Whether Tesco is entitled to recover damages for deceit and conspiracy
  3. 3 Appropriate quantum of compensatory and exemplary damages

Ratio Decidendi

The court found the accident was staged as part of a large-scale conspiracy to defraud Tesco, with Khattawi and Taylor both active participants. Tesco was entitled to recover the interim payment, repair costs, and investigation costs. Given the scale and egregiousness of the fraud, exemplary damages of £20,000 were awarded against Khattawi and £18,000 against Taylor.

Court Disposition

Judgment for the Claimant

Orders

  • Khattawi to pay Tesco £27,108 (interim payment), £232.73 (repair costs), £1,677.60 (investigation costs), and £20,000 (exemplary damages)
  • Taylor to pay Tesco £1,677.60 (investigation costs) and £18,000 (exemplary damages)
